What's the lowest size dumpster available?
The lowest size roll off dumpster usually available is 10 yards. This container will carry about 10 cubic yards of waste and debris, which is approximately equal to 3 to 5 pickup truck loads of waste. This dumpster is a great option for small jobs, such as little house cleanouts.
Other examples of jobs that a 10 yard container would function well for contain: A garage, shed or attic cleanout A 250 square foot deck removal 2,000 to 2,500 square feet of single layer roofing shingles A small kitchen or bathroom remodeling job Concrete or soil removal Getting rid of trash Take note that weight restrictions for the containers are enforced, thus exceeding the weight limit will incur additional charges. The normal weight limitation for a 10 yard bin is 1 to 3 tons (2,000 to 6,000 pounds).
A 10 yard bin will allow you to take good care of small jobs around the house. For those who have a bigger job coming up, take a look at some bigger containers too.
Construction Dumpster Rental in Watkins - Do You Need One?
Although local governments commonly provide waste disposal services, very few of them are going to haul away construction debris. This makes it important for individuals to rent dumpsters so they can dispose of waste during construction endeavors.
The most common exception to this rule is when you have a truck that's large enough to transport all construction debris to a landfill or landfill drop off point. In case you're working on a tiny bathroom remodeling project, for instance, you may find you could fit all of the debris in a truck bed.
Other than very little projects, it's recommended that you rent a dumpster in Watkins for construction projects.
If you're not sure whether your municipality accepts construction debris, contact the city for more advice. You'll likely find you will need to rent a dumpster in Watkins. Setting debris outside for garbage removal could possibly lead to fines.

What Types of Debris Can I Put Into a Dumpster?
It's possible for you to put most forms of debris into a dumpster rental in Watkins. There are, nevertheless, some exclusions. For instance, you cannot put substances into a dumpster. That includes motor oil, paints, solvents, automotive fluids, pesticides, and cleaning agents. Electronic Equipment and batteries are also banned. If something introduces an environmental danger, you likely cannot set it in a dumpster. Contact your rental company if you're uncertain.
That makes most varieties of debris that you could set in the dumpster, contain drywall, concrete, lumber, and yard waste. Pretty much any type of debris left from a construction job can go in the dumpster.
Certain kinds of satisfactory debris, nevertheless, may require additional fees. In case you plan to throw away used tires, mattresses, or appliances, you need to request the rental company whether you need to pay an additional fee. Adding these to your dumpster may cost anywhere from $25 to $100, depending on the thing.

Do I require a permit to rent a dumpster in Watkins?
If that is your first time renting a dumpster in Watkins, you may not know what is legally permissible in regards to the placement of the dumpster. If your plan is to put the dumpster entirely on your own property, you're not ordinarily required to get a permit.
If, nevertheless, your job needs you to place the dumpster on a public road or roadway, this may under normal conditions mean that you have to apply for a permit. It is always a good idea to consult your local city or county offices (possibly the parking enforcement division) in case you own a question regarding the need for a permit on a road.
Should you don't obtain a permit and find out afterwards that you were required to have one, you may probably face a fine from your local authorities. In most dumpster rental in Watkins cases, though, you should be just fine without a permit as long as you keep the dumpster on your property.

How high can I fill my dumpster?
You can fill your dumpster as full as you like, so long as you don't load it higher in relation to the sides of the container. Over filling the dumpster could cause the waste or debris to slide off as the dumpster is loaded onto the truck or as the truck is driving. Overloaded or big-boned dumpsters are just not safe, and firms don't carry unsafe loads in order to protect drivers and passengers on the road.
In certain places, dumpster loads must be tarped for security. In case your load is too high, it will not be able to be tarped so you will have to remove some of the debris before it can be hauled away. This might result in additional fees if it demands you to keep the dumpster for a longer duration of time. Don't forget to keep your load no higher in relation to the sides of the dumpster, and you will be fine.
What is the biggest size dumpster available?
The biggest roll off dumpster that firms normally rent is a 40 yard container. This massive dumpster will hold up to 40 cubic yards of debris, which is comparable to between 12 and 20 pickup truck loads of debris.
The weight limitation on 40 yard containers generally ranges from 4 to 8 tons (8,000 to 16,000 pounds). Be very conscious of the limitation and do your best not to exceed it. Should you go over the limit, you can incur overage charges, which add up fast.
Examples of projects that a 40 yard container will likely be the right size for contain: A foreclosure or estate cleanout A 750 square foot deck removal 4,000 square feet of roofing shingles in multiple layers Whole-home interior renovation Getting rid of junk when you're moving in or out House demolition New house construction Commercial and residential cleanouts

Front-load vs Rolloff Dumpsters
Front -load and roll-off dumpsters have different layouts that make them useful in various ways. Knowing more about them will help you select an alternative that is right for your project.
Front-load dumpsters have mechanical arms that may lift heavy objects. This really is a handy choice for jobs that comprise a lot of heavy things like appliances and concrete. They're also good for emptying commercial dumpsters like the sort eateries use.
Rolloff DumpstersRolloff dumpsters are usually the right choice for commercial and residential jobs like repairing a roof, remodeling a cellar, or adding a room to your residence. They've doors that swing open, letting you walk into the dumpster. Additionally they have open tops that allow you to throw debris into the container. Rental businesses will usually leave a roll-off dumpster at your project location for several days or weeks. This really is a handy choice for both small and large jobs.
